Subject: [PATCH resend 2/5] input: touchscreen: Add LED trigger support to the softbutton code
Date: Sun, 11 Sep 2016 20:44:05 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20160911184408.11657-3-hdegoede@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20160911184408.11657-1-hdegoede@redhat.com>
In some hardware there are 1 or more LEDs behind the touchscreen
softbuttons, which are intended to provide visual feedback to the
user that the softbutton has been pressed, this commit adds support
for this.

diff --git a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/input/touchscreen/softbuttons.txt b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/input/touchscreen/softbuttons.txt
index 3eb6f4c..b425b95 100644
--- a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/input/touchscreen/softbuttons.txt
+++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/input/touchscreen/softbuttons.txt
@@ -17,6 +17,10 @@ Required subnode-properties:
- softbutton-min-y : Y start of the area the softbutton area covers
- softbutton-max-y : Y end of the area the softbutton area covers
+Optional subnode-properties:
+- linux,led-trigger : String for a LED trigger for providing visual
+ feedback that the softbutton has been pressed
+
Example:
#include <dt-bindings/input/input.h>
diff --git a/drivers/input/touchscreen/softbuttons.c b/drivers/input/touchscreen/softbuttons.c
index 47aea18..9a3fbfa 100644
--- a/drivers/input/touchscreen/softbuttons.c
+++ b/drivers/input/touchscreen/softbuttons.c
@@ -11,6 +11,7 @@
#include <linux/input.h>
#include <linux/input/touchscreen.h>
+#include <linux/leds.h>
#include <linux/of.h>
struct touchscreen_softbutton {
@@ -19,6 +20,8 @@ struct touchscreen_softbutton {
u32 min_y;
u32 max_y;
u32 keycode;
+ const char *ledtrigger_name;
+ struct led_trigger *ledtrigger;
};
struct touchscreen_softbutton_info {
@@ -48,7 +51,7 @@ struct touchscreen_softbutton_info *devm_touchscreen_alloc_softbuttons(
struct device *dev = input->dev.parent;
struct device_node *np, *pp;
struct touchscreen_softbutton_info *info;
- int i, err, button_count;
+ int i, j, err, button_count;
np = dev->of_node;
if (!np)
@@ -103,6 +106,36 @@ struct touchscreen_softbutton_info *devm_touchscreen_alloc_softbuttons(
dev_err(dev, "%s: Inval max-y prop\n", pp->name);
return ERR_PTR(-EINVAL);
}
+
+ err = of_property_read_string(pp, "linux,led-trigger",
+ &btn->ledtrigger_name);
+ if (err)
+ continue; /* The LED trigger is optional */
+
+ /* Check if another softbutton uses the same trigger */
+ for (j = 0; j < i; j++) {
+ if (info->buttons[j].ledtrigger_name &&
+ strcmp(info->buttons[j].ledtrigger_name,
+ btn->ledtrigger_name) == 0) {
+ btn->ledtrigger = info->buttons[j].ledtrigger;
+ break;
+ }
+ }
+ if (!btn->ledtrigger) {
+ btn->ledtrigger =
+ devm_kzalloc(dev, sizeof(*btn->ledtrigger),
+ GFP_KERNEL);
+ if (!btn->ledtrigger)
+ return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M);
+
+ btn->ledtrigger->name = btn->ledtrigger_name;
+ err = devm_led_trigger_register(dev, btn->ledtrigger);
+ if (err) {
+ dev_err(dev, "%s: Ledtrigger register error\n",
+ pp->name);
+ return ERR_PTR(err);
+ }
+ }
}
__set_bit(EV_KEY, input->evbit);
@@ -126,6 +159,7 @@ bool touchscreen_handle_softbuttons(struct touchscreen_softbutton_info *info,
unsigned int x, unsigned int y, bool down)
{
int i;
+ unsigned long led_delay = 1000; /* Keep the led on 1s after release */
if (info == NULL)
return false;
@@ -137,6 +171,19 @@ bool touchscreen_handle_softbuttons(struct touchscreen_softbutton_info *info,
y <= info->buttons[i].max_y) {
input_report_key(info->input,
info->buttons[i].keycode, down);
+
+ if (info->buttons[i].ledtrigger && down) {
+ led_trigger_event(info->buttons[i].ledtrigger,
+ LED_FULL);
+ } else if (info->buttons[i].ledtrigger && !down) {
+ /* Led must be off before calling blink */
+ led_trigger_event(info->buttons[i].ledtrigger,
+ LED_OFF);
+ led_trigger_blink_oneshot(
+ info->buttons[i].ledtrigger,
+ &led_delay, &led_delay, 0);
+ }
+
return true;
}
}
